高三数学算法与程序框图.docx

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
§9.1算法与程序框图 §9.1算法与程序框图 双基研习?面对高考 考点探究?挑战咼考 考向瞭望?把脉高考 双基研习?面对高考 基础梳理 ] 算 的; 算法是解决鬆 问题的一系列 步骤 或 程序. 2?排序问题 (1)有序列直接插入排序 按照一定的顺序排列的数据列,我们称之为 有序列 ? 有序列插入排序就是找到要插入的数据在已知有 序列中的位置,然后把它插入进去,组成新的有 序列. 折半插入排序方法 先逍新数据与有序列中“中间位置”的那个数据 进行比较,“中间位置”的数据将数列分为两半, 当新数据较小时,它的位置血在蠡右的反一辜, 否则,在靠右的这一半. 算法的基本结构 称 顺序结构 选择结构 循环结构 定义 按照步骤 依次执仃 的一个算法,称 为具有“顺序结 构”的算法,或 者称备法的顺 序结构— ■ 在算法的执行过 程中,需要对 条件进行判断, 判断的结果 决定后面的步骤, 像这样的结构通 常称作选择结构. 在一些算法中,经 常会出现从某处开 始,按照一定的条 件,反复执行某一 处理步骤的情况, 像这种需要 反复执行 的结 构称为循环结构. 顺序结构 选择结构 循环结构 步骤n 算法框 图 步骤?+1 1=思考感悟 三种基本结构的共同点是什么? 提示:三种结构的共同点,即只有一个入口和 一个出口,每一个基本结构的每一部分都有机 会被执行到,而且结构内不存在死循环. 1= 课前热知 1.(教材习题改编)用折半插入法把52插入有序 列{13,27,51,57,82},构成一个新的有序列,共 需比较的次数为( A. 1 ) B. 2 C. 3 D. 4 答案:B 2.如下图所示的程序框图输出的结果是() A. 1C. 5 A. 1 C. 5 B. 20 D. 10 答案:B 3-(2010年高考辽宁勸如果执行如图所示的程序框 图,输入n=6, m=4,那么输出的卩等于() k=k^l是 k=k^l 是 B. 360 D. 120720 B. 360 D. 120 C. 240 答案:B 4.如图是某个函数求值的程序框图,则满足 该程序的函数解析式为 ? CW3 答案:f(x)= 2x—3, x0 5 — 4x,兀MO 5?一个算法如下: 第一步:S取值0, i取值1? 第二步:若i不大于10,则执行下一步;否则 执行第六步. 第三步:计算S+i且将结果代替S. 第四步:用 第四步: 用i+2结果代替L 第五步:转去执行第二步. 第六步:输出S? 则运行以上步骤输出的结果为 答案:25 考点探究?挑战高考 算法框图的顺序结构和选择结构 顺序结构是最简单的算法结构,语句与语句之 间、框与框之间是按步骤顺序进行的.流程图中 选择结构中舄含?一个判断框,根据给定的条件 是否成立而选择步骤甲或步骤乙. )(2010年高考湖南卷)如图是求实数 )(2010年高考湖南卷)如图是求实数r绝对 值的算法程序框图,贝!I判断框①中可填 /输入% //输出兀〃输出-兀/ 一」「结束〕 /输入% / /输出兀〃输出-兀/ 一」 「结束〕 算法的循环结构 算法的循环结构 循环结构有两种形式,即当型和直到型.这两 种形式的循环结构在执行流程上有所不同,当 型循环是当条件满足时执行循环体,不满足时 退出循环体;而直到型循环则是当条件不满足 时执行循环体,满足时退出循环体. 0^(2010年高考课标全国卷)如果 执行如图所示的框图,输入N=5,贝!| 输出的数等于() 5-4 6-5? ? A C4- 5 5-4 6-5 ? ? A C 4- 5 5-^6 B.D 【思路点拨】 析出该程序框图的功能进行求解? 【解析】 根据程序框图可知,该程序框图的 功能是计算S = 七 + 氏 + 土+??? + EX(;+1),现在输入的N=5,所以输出的结果 __11 1 11__ 1 为 5=lX2+2X3+3X4+45+56= (1_2 +g-》+???+(H)W,故选d. 【答案】D 【名师点评】 识别运行算法框图和完善算法 框图是高考的热点.解答这一类问题,第一, 要明确算法框图的顺序结构、选择结构和循环 结构;第二,要识别运行算法框图,理解框图 所解决的实际问题;第三,按照题目的要求完 成解答.对算法框图的考查常与数列和函数等 知识相结合,进一步强化框图问题的实际背 景. 变式训练1 (2010年高考/输出s /(结束]内容为()陕西勸如图是求X], x2, …,工 变式训练1 (2010年高考 /输出s / (结束] 内容为() A? S=S*(〃 + 1) S=S*x“+i S=S*n D?S=S忧 解析:选D.由题意可知,输出的是io个数 的乘积,故循环体应%S=S*兀. 72 算法的设计 画算法框图的规则: 使用标准的框图符号; 框图

您可能关注的文档

文档评论(0)

梦幻飞迷0411 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档